#include <sys/cdefs.h>
__KERNEL_RCSID(0, "$NetBSD: mpc5200_ohci.c,v 1.1 2026/06/27 13:28:35 rkujawa Exp $");
#include <sys/param.h>
#include <sys/bus.h>
#include <sys/device.h>
#include <sys/intr.h>
#include <sys/systm.h>
#include <sys/kernel.h>
#include <dev/ofw/openfirm.h>
#include <dev/usb/usb.h>
#include <dev/usb/usbdi.h>
#include <dev/usb/usbdivar.h>
#include <dev/usb/usb_mem.h>
#include <dev/usb/ohcireg.h>
#include <dev/usb/ohcivar.h>
#include <powerpc/mpc5200/obiovar.h>
#include <powerpc/mpc5200/mpc5200reg.h>
#include <powerpc/mpc5200/mpc5200_ohcivar.h>
static int mpc5200_ohci_match(device_t, cfdata_t, void *);
static void mpc5200_ohci_attach(device_t, device_t, void *);
CFATTACH_DECL2_NEW(ohci_obio, sizeof(struct mpc5200_ohci_softc),
mpc5200_ohci_match, mpc5200_ohci_attach, NULL, ohci_activate,
NULL, ohci_childdet);
static int
mpc5200_ohci_match(device_t parent, cfdata_t cf, void *aux)
{
struct obio_attach_args *oba = aux;
char compat[40];
int len;
if (strcmp(oba->obio_name, "usb") == 0)
return 1;
len = OF_getprop(oba->obio_node, "compatible", compat, sizeof(compat));
if (len > 0 &&
(strcmp(compat, "mpc5200-ohci") == 0 ||
strcmp(compat, "mpc5200b-ohci") == 0 ||
strcmp(compat, "mpc5200-usb-ohci") == 0 ||
strcmp(compat, "mpc5200b-usb-ohci") == 0))
return 1;
return 0;
}
static void
mpc5200_ohci_attach(device_t parent, device_t self, void *aux)
{
struct mpc5200_ohci_softc *msc = device_private(self);
ohci_softc_t *sc = &msc->sc;
struct obio_attach_args *oba = aux;
bus_addr_t addr;
bus_size_t size;
int ist, error;
sc->sc_dev = self;
sc->sc_bus.ub_hcpriv = sc;
sc->sc_bus.ub_dmatag = oba->obio_dmat;
sc->iot = oba->obio_bst;
sc->sc_endian = OHCI_HOST_ENDIAN;
addr = oba->obio_addr != 0 ? oba->obio_addr :
MPC5200_MBAR_DEFAULT + MPC5200_REG_USB;
size = oba->obio_size != 0 ? oba->obio_size : MPC5200_USB_SIZE;
sc->sc_size = size;
aprint_naive("\n");
aprint_normal(": MPC5200 USB OHCI\n");
if (bus_space_map(sc->iot, addr, size, 0, &sc->ioh) != 0) {
aprint_error_dev(self, "can't map registers\n");
return;
}
bus_space_write_4(sc->iot, sc->ioh, OHCI_INTERRUPT_DISABLE,
OHCI_ALL_INTRS);
if (!obio_decode_interrupt(oba->obio_node, 0, &msc->sc_irq, &ist)) {
aprint_error_dev(self, "can't decode interrupt\n");
goto fail_unmap;
}
msc->sc_ih = intr_establish(msc->sc_irq, ist, IPL_USB, ohci_intr, sc);
if (msc->sc_ih == NULL) {
aprint_error_dev(self, "can't establish interrupt\n");
goto fail_unmap;
}
error = ohci_init(sc);
if (error != 0) {
aprint_error_dev(self, "init failed, error=%d\n", error);
goto fail_intr;
}
if (!pmf_device_register1(self, NULL, NULL, ohci_shutdown))
aprint_error_dev(self, "can't establish power handler\n");
sc->sc_child = config_found(self, &sc->sc_bus, usbctlprint,
CFARGS_NONE);
return;
fail_intr:
intr_disestablish(msc->sc_ih);
msc->sc_ih = NULL;
fail_unmap:
bus_space_unmap(sc->iot, sc->ioh, size);
sc->sc_size = 0;
}
